What Is BillPay?

BillPay for US startups refers to digital payment tools that allow businesses to pay bills electronically. Instead of writing paper checks or logging into multiple websites, you can manage payments from one centralized place—saving time and minimizing errors.

BillPay tools are commonly built into online banking platforms or financial software tailored for small businesses. These tools are particularly helpful for startups aiming to stay organized, timely, and compliant.

Key features of BillPay:

  • Electronic payments to vendors, contractors, and service providers

  • Automated scheduling for both one-time and recurring payments

  • Invoice uploading and digitization for faster processing

  • Payment tracking and real-time status updates

  • Integrated approval workflows for secure and structured spending

  • Compatibility with accounting services for easier financial reconciliation

Why BillPay Matters for US Startups

Startups often face resource limitations—whether it’s budget, headcount, or time. BillPay helps bridge those gaps through automation and financial visibility, both of which support smarter business decisions.

Here’s how BillPay benefits US small businesses:

1. Streamlined Operations

  • Reduces the need for manual processing and paper-based systems

  • Minimizes human errors caused by repetitive tasks

  • Saves time for founders and teams to focus on growth

2. Smarter Cash Flow Management

  • Aligns outgoing bills with revenue cycles

  • Avoids overdraft fees and cash shortfalls

  • Helps plan around burn rate and runway

3. Stronger Vendor Relationships

  • Ensures timely payments—critical to building trust

  • Enhances credibility during your startup’s early stages

  • Supports better vendor terms and future opportunities

4. Clearer Financial Oversight

  • Offers dashboards to track due dates, amounts, and payment status

  • Improves budgeting, forecasting, and reconciliation

  • Adds a layer of visibility across departments or stakeholders

5. Security and Compliance

  • Provides audit trails for every payment

  • Uses secure encryption and authorization protocols

  • Helps meet compliance needs for regulated industries
